Transaction 268a19ba23f86edfc72e312e4195b77693f1261e27992371a46f5bc43bbf9c69
1 Input
1 Output
-
268a19ba23f86edfc72e312e4195b77693f1261e27992371a46f5bc43bbf9c69:0
- value
- 38481
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6f53b675f5705ce4c739f320f0170339e2abae8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HgPkwCN8JNH9d5P6hxPDZB3wWfPZGAaPB